clearvision - importing with jim and other tools

22
Clearvision CM Atlassian APE Migrating to Jira using JIM (and other tools)

Upload: london-ape

Post on 18-Nov-2014

569 views

Category:

Technology


0 download

DESCRIPTION

 

TRANSCRIPT

Page 1: Clearvision - Importing with JIM and other tools

Clearvision CMAtlassian APE

Migrating to Jira using JIM (and other tools)

Page 2: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Agenda

• Who are Clearvision?• Why Migrate to Jira?• The old ways…• The new ways…

• Jira Importer

• An example of migrating from ClearQuest to Jira

• Additional challenges, information and hints• Affinity

• v1.0• v2.0

Page 3: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Who are Clearvision?

• Gerald Tombs, Technical Director• 25 years of software development experience• 15 years of Configuration Management

• Andy Pallett, Software Developer

• Company History• Partnerships with IBM Rational, Atlassian,

Intland, Black Duck• Specialise in Open Source technologies

Page 4: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Why migrate to Jira?

Page 5: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

A few reasons…

• Because you have issues! (sorry…)• Mergers and Acquisitions• Licensing costs• Greater efficiency and productivity• Scalability and extensibility• Reduced Administration overhead

Page 6: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

The old way

• Long-winded, hard to read scripts• Bugzilla to Jira @ 2,332 lines

• Interacting at a Database level• Dangerous• Could potentially cause huge amounts of

downtime• Future upgrades could be a pain• Slow

Page 7: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Jira Importer

Page 8: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

The new way!

• A Jira Plugin• Comes bundled with Jira installations

• Built-in importers• Bugzilla (> v2.0)• FogBugz Server (Behind Firewall or Hosted)• Mantis (> v2.0)• Pivotal Tracker (>v2.5)• Trac (>2.6.1)

• CSV Importer

Page 9: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

From ClearQuest to Jira

• An example of using the JIM

• Screenshots and explanations to follow…

Page 10: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

ClearQuest to Jira – .csv file

Page 11: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

ClearQuest to Jira – Mappings

Page 12: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

ClearQuest to Jira – Mappings

Page 13: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

ClearQuest to Jira – Complete

Page 14: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

ClearQuest to Jira – Importing

Page 15: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

ClearQuest to Jira – Importing

Page 16: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

ClearQuest to Jira – Log OutputINFO - ------------------------------INFO - Importing: IssuesINFO - ------------------------------INFO - Only new items will be importedINFO - Importing issue: ExternalIssue{externalId=autoid-XXX, summary=spelling error in login screen, issueType=null}INFO - Importing issue: ExternalIssue{externalId=autoid-XXX, summary=sales tax incorrect if item deleted, issueType=null}INFO - Importing issue: ExternalIssue{externalId=autoid-XXX, summary=cancel sale doesn't correctly repaint, issueType=null}INFO - Importing issue: ExternalIssue{externalId=autoid-XXX, summary=want more help on inventory report, issueType=null}INFO - Importing issue: ExternalIssue{externalId=autoid-XXX, summary=columns out of alignment, issueType=null}

Page 17: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Additional Information

• When using an exported CSV from ClearQuest, additional tweaks still required• New lines require ‘escape characters’• Multi-value select fields

• Could bulk edit issues, but not always an option

• Currently, links are not supported between issues

Page 18: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Affinity

Page 19: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Affinity

• Developed by Clearvision in 2011

• Currently at version 1.0• Delivered as part of a professional service

• Developed to make a Consultants life easier

• 4 steps to complete migration• Data export• Mapping generation• Data mapping• Data import

Page 20: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Affinity Bridging

• Nearing the end of development

• v2.0 will be released with Jira to Jira functionality• Bi-directional bridging• Server and Jira Plugin

• Jira CQ to be released soon after v2.0

Page 21: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Overview

• Background of Clearvision• Why more companies are migrating to

Jira• Old migration techniques• New, faster and safer migration

techniques• A working example – ClearQuest to Jira

via JIM• Introduction to Affinity v1.0

• And the upcoming Affinity v2.0 (including bridging!)

Page 22: Clearvision - Importing with JIM and other tools

http://www.clearvision-cm.com

Thanks for listeningAny questions?